    The Department of Defense, through the Defense Logistics Agency, is seeking potential sources to manufacture and supply safety relief valves, specifically NSN 4820-00-337-3985RK, for use at Tinker Air Force Base in Oklahoma. This Sources Sought Synopsis aims to gather market research information to assess the capabilities of various businesses, including small and disadvantaged enterprises, to determine the feasibility of a Small Business Set-Aside for this procurement. The safety relief valves are critical components in aircraft systems, ensuring operational safety and efficiency. Interested vendors are encouraged to submit their business information using the provided form and must select the “Add Me to Interested Vendors” option to participate; for inquiries, they can contact 423 SCMS at 423.SCMS.AFMC.RFI@us.af.mil. Please note that this notice is for informational purposes only, and no contracts will be awarded from this announcement.
